Output 69632355bc24f001487ebb7189d802f9efac6e6b990c315ad6163b5383e5f117:0

value
1025266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5c2b205f88aabda38697be9977c0d82e392993 OP_EQUAL
address
3MsTfv3Sh1ncyw1Csbvpxe5xsYXgxjKuUe
transaction
69632355bc24f001487ebb7189d802f9efac6e6b990c315ad6163b5383e5f117
spent
true